Merge master.
[dcpomatic.git] / src / wx / wscript
index 20e2e7c43640814bae85b1582577c35ab2c42e2e..bb530989452cee3e6558a322f85cafb83197bde6 100644 (file)
@@ -38,6 +38,7 @@ sources = """
           server_dialog.cc
           servers_list_dialog.cc
           subtitle_panel.cc
+          subtitle_view.cc
           table_dialog.cc
           timecode.cc
           timeline.cc
@@ -63,7 +64,7 @@ def configure(conf):
         conf.env.STLIB_WXWIDGETS = ['wx_gtk2u_richtext-3.0', 'wx_gtk2u_xrc-3.0', 'wx_gtk2u_qa-3.0', 'wx_baseu_net-3.0', 'wx_gtk2u_html-3.0',
                                     'wx_gtk2u_adv-3.0', 'wx_gtk2u_core-3.0', 'wx_baseu_xml-3.0', 'wx_baseu-3.0']
         conf.env.LIB_WXWIDGETS = ['tiff', 'SM', 'dl', 'jpeg', 'png', 'X11', 'expat']
-        if conf.env.TARGET_DEBIAN:
+        if conf.env.TARGET_DEBIAN and conf.env.DEBIAN_UNSTABLE:
             conf.env.LIB_WXWIDGETS.append('Xxf86vm')
             conf.env.LIB_WXWIDGETS.append('Xext')
             conf.env.LIB_WXWIDGETS.append('X11')
@@ -71,8 +72,8 @@ def configure(conf):
     conf.in_msg = 1
     wx_version = conf.check_cfg(package='', path=conf.options.wx_config, args='--version').strip()
     conf.im_msg = 0
-    if wx_version != '3.0.0':
-        conf.fatal('wxwidgets version 3.0.0 is required; %s found' % wx_version)
+    if not wx_version.startswith('3.0.'):
+        conf.fatal('wxwidgets version 3.0.x is required; %s found' % wx_version)
 
 def build(bld):
     if bld.env.BUILD_STATIC: